Copper Cathode Production: From Mining to Refinement
The journey of copper cathode begins with mining ore from the ground . Initial processing involves pulverizing the material to liberate the metallic minerals . Following a step, refining read more techniques, such as bubble separation , are employed to enrich the base content. Subsequently , smelting transforms the material into molten metal . Ultimately , electrochemical methods purify the substance further, resulting in high-purity metallic plates suitable for multiple applications .
